Job description

About the Role
Based in Erlanger, KY, this position will support the tracking of all linehaul trailer moves, and execute department specific functions, to ensure Gap Inc. shipments meet service requirements. The work performed will help ensure the successful movement and delivery of all Gap Inc. product into and out of our Distribution Centers. This position interacts with individuals both independently and in conjunction with other internal and external stakeholders. You will perform key functions that directly impact the ability for our DCs and Stores to have the right product, at the right time, to sell to the end customer. You will also have the opportunity to interact directly with our third-part delivery providers, and stores, to resolve exceptions.

This position is seasonal (lasting for 6 months) and is 40-hours per week (Monday through Friday). It is required to work from the office, but has the option to work remote on Friday, through Labor Day.
What You'll Do
  • Responsible for the track & trace of ground freight shipments, across the U.S. and Canada
  • Expedite product that is designated as priority by our brands
  • Utilize system capabilities, and available data, to drive end-to-end tracking execution, and service
  • Act as an immediate point-of-contact, for internal and external business partners, to report freight that has been delayed
  • Cultivate partnerships with external carriers and hold accountable to service targets
  • Anticipate areas of potential risk in the network, collaborate with other team members, and take actions to mitigate
  • Establish impact of late product and provide visibility to relevant stakeholders
  • Perform daily transportation procedures/operations and execute against documented processes
  • Assist leaders on key projects, by providing support and analysis, as needed, or requested
Who You Are
  • Strong communication skills, both written and verbal

  • Ability to effectively prioritize time-sensitive projects and act with a sense of urgency

  • Strong attention to detail

  • Strong problem-solving, organizational, planning, analytical and decision-making skills

  • Ability to make decisions independently and work with minimal supervision

  • Ability to work effectively in a diverse team environment

  • Strong ownership and accountability
